BA (Hons) Marketing
Key modules
- Marketing Foundations
- Introduction to Creative Concepts and Design
- Marketing Insights and Analytics
Our standard BA (Hons) Marketing course is for those who want to pick up skills in a wide variety of subjects linked to the area. Although all students have the option to switch to a specialist pathway after their first year should they find a topic they really enjoy, you can also just as easily opt to cherry-pick modules that interest you in your second or third year from across different specialisms.
BA (Hons) Marketing (Advertising and PR)
Key modules
- Marketing Communications Planning
- Visual Communication for Marketers
- Public Relations Planning and Corporate Reputation
This specialism is designed for those that want to work in the public facing sectors of consumer advertising and public relations. You need only walk down a street to see the far-reaching presence advertising has in our lives. And with more and more firms taking notice of their public profile, PR workers are becoming a more common sight. Both areas of study will set you up to be able to find the best ways possible of selling any given product or business to the target audience.
BA (Hons) Marketing (Consumer Psychology)
Key modules
- Managing Behavioural Change
- Neuropsychology
- Cross-culture Consumer Behaviour
If you’ve ever wondered about the tried and tested insider tactics marketers use to sell their products, our Consumer Psychology pathway is the right choice for you. This course delves deep into the theory behind modern marketing techniques, looking to analyse why humans act in certain ways to given advertisements. From this, innovative new ideas that shake up the market can be devised.
BA (Hons) Marketing (Digital)
Key modules
- Content Marketing Strategy
- User Experience and Architecture
- Digital Enterprise
Digital advertising is still a developing sector – as more and more of our lives are spent online, marketing agencies need to adapt to this new way of selling products. Our Digital pathway will help give you the insight into how traditional marketing methods are being adapted to suit the digital medium, and explore what new developments are emerging in the area. The internet isn’t going anywhere, so it’s a great time to specialise in digital marketing!
BA (Hons) Marketing (Retailing)
Key modules
- Channel Management and Routes to Market
- Retail Operations
- Service Experience Design
Our Retailing pathway is concerned with the whole shopping experience, combining advertising with operations, store management and everything else that goes into making a consumer’s experience enjoyable. Shops are an extension of a company’s brand – compare the sleek stylings of a River Island with the child-friendly, exciting interiors of Build-A-Bear Workshop, for example – and our Retailing pathway will give you the skills to strike the right tone throughout your customer’s journey.
